diff -r 023eef975703 -r abc41079b313 javauis/mmapi_qt/animated_gif_notUsed/inc/cmmaanimationstoptimecontrol.h --- a/javauis/mmapi_qt/animated_gif_notUsed/inc/cmmaanimationstoptimecontrol.h Fri Jul 09 16:35:45 2010 +0300 +++ /dev/null Thu Jan 01 00:00:00 1970 +0000 @@ -1,50 +0,0 @@ -/* -* Copyright (c) 2002 Nokia Corporation and/or its subsidiary(-ies). -* All rights reserved. -* This component and the accompanying materials are made available -* under the terms of "Eclipse Public License v1.0" -* which accompanies this distribution, and is available -* at the URL "http://www.eclipse.org/legal/epl-v10.html". -* -* Initial Contributors: -* Nokia Corporation - initial contribution. -* -* Contributors: -* -* Description: This class is used for stoptime controlling for animation player -* -*/ - - -#ifndef CMMAANIMATIONSTOPTIMECONTROL_H -#define CMMAANIMATIONSTOPTIMECONTROL_H - -// INCLUDES -#include "cmmaanimationplayer.h" -#include "cmmastoptimecontrol.h" - -// CLASS DECLARATION -/** -* This class is used for stoptime controlling for animation -* -* -*/ - -NONSHARABLE_CLASS(CMMAAnimationStopTimeControl): public CMMAStopTimeControl, - public MMMAAnimationObserver -{ -public: - static CMMAAnimationStopTimeControl* NewL(CMMAAnimationPlayer* aPlayer); - ~CMMAAnimationStopTimeControl(); - -protected: - CMMAAnimationStopTimeControl(CMMAAnimationPlayer* aPlayer); - -public: // from CMMAStopTimeControl - void SetStopTimeL(const TInt64& aTime); - -public: // from MMMAAnimationObserver - void AnimationAdvancedL(TInt aFrame, TInt64 aMediaTime); -}; - -#endif // CMMAANIMATIONSTOPTIMECONTROL_H